Update Info - Joyce's Corner Kitchen
This restaurant was reported as closed. If it is open, let us know.
Joyce's Corner Kitchen
730 Carroll St
Saint Louis, MO 63104
730 Carroll St
Saint Louis, MO 63104
This restaurant was reported as closed. If it is open, let us know.